As a Paramedic Qualifications Analyst, you will play a critical role in ensuring that paramedics meet all regulatory and operational requirements to safely deliver care. This position is responsible for maintaining and validating qualifications, certifications, and compliance records in alignment with Ministry of Health (MOH) and Transport Canada (TC) standards. You’ll be at the heart of operational readiness by partnering with clinical, operational, and regulatory stakeholders to ensure every paramedic is fully qualified, compliant, and ready to respond when it matters most.

Key Accountabilities:

  • Manage and update electronic databases and documentation for paramedic qualifications, ensuring accuracy, completeness, and alignment with regulatory standards.
  • Track certification status, proactively notify staff and leadership of expirations, and generate regular reports to support operational planning and compliance.
  • Prepare and submit documentation for MOH licensing, process identification cards, and manage onboarding/offboarding qualification requirements for staff and observers.
  • Perform routine audits of qualification files, identify gaps or inconsistencies, and ensure compliance with provincial and federal regulations through corrective action.
  • Contribute to continuous improvement initiatives by identifying opportunities to streamline processes, enhance data accuracy, and optimize workflows across qualification management systems
  • Provide documentation and reporting support for audits, inspections, and accreditation processes, ensuring readiness at all times.
